Jon's Current Read

Everina Homes 4Th Add is a small pocket subdivision in Brandon, and with a closings window this thin, there is no reliable price band to quote here. What sells and for how much is going to be driven almost entirely by the individual home — its condition, updates, and lot — rather than by any neighborhood-wide trend you can lean on.

For a buyer, that means comparables are scarce and each listing has to be underwritten on its own merits. For a seller, it means pricing off the specific property and the broader Hillsborough County market, not off a handful of nearby closings that may not represent your home.

A small-sample submarket

With only a short closings window on record as of mid-2026, Everina Homes 4Th Add does not generate enough recent sales to build a dependable pricing picture. That is not a knock on the community — it is simply the reality of a small addition where homes trade infrequently.

The practical effect is that value here is condition-driven and property-specific. Two homes on the same street can price very differently depending on updates and upkeep, and you should expect to look beyond the immediate subdivision to the surrounding Brandon market to establish a fair number.
